NASA的软件开发项目经理手册

3星 · 超过75%的资源 需积分: 10 2 下载量 60 浏览量 更新于2024-07-28 收藏 617KB PDF 举报
"《项目经理手册之软件开发》是来源于网络工程领域的资料,文件格式为PDF,适用于Windows平台。这份手册经过了验证,免费提供给读者使用。由NASA/Goddard Space Flight Center的软件工程实验室(SEL)出版,修订版本为1,发布日期为1990年11月。它属于SOFTWARE ENGINEERING LABORATORY SERIES系列,旨在研究软件工程技术和方法在应用软件开发中的效果。" 《项目经理手册之软件开发》是一份深入探讨软件项目管理的专业指南,特别关注于NASA/GSFC环境下的软件开发过程。该手册的前言指出,软件工程实验室(SEL)是由NASA/GSFC与马里兰大学计算机科学系及Computer Sciences Corporation的Flight Dynamics Technology Group共同设立的机构,成立于1977年。其主要目标包括: 1. 理解NASA/GSFC环境中的软件开发过程:这涉及到对软件生命周期的全面了解,包括需求分析、设计、编码、测试和维护等各个阶段。 2. 测量不同方法论、工具和技术对这个过程的影响:手册可能涵盖了各种软件开发模型,如瀑布模型、迭代模型、敏捷开发等,并评估它们在实际项目中的效果。 3. 识别并推广成功的开发实践:通过实证研究,手册会总结出能够提高效率、降低成本、增强软件质量和可维护性的最佳实践。 手册的内容可能包括但不限于以下几个方面: - 软件项目规划:如何制定合理的项目计划,包括时间表、预算、人力资源分配等。 - 风险管理:识别、评估和应对软件开发过程中可能出现的技术和管理风险。 - 团队协作与沟通:促进团队内部的有效沟通,确保信息流动顺畅。 - 质量保证:实施质量控制策略,确保软件产品的质量和可靠性。 - 变更管理:如何处理项目需求变更,以及变更对进度和成本的影响。 - 评估与度量:如何设置和使用关键性能指标(KPIs)来监控项目的进度和成果。 - 工具和技术选择:推荐和解释适用于不同阶段的开发工具和方法。 - 教育和培训:提升团队成员的技能和知识,以适应不断变化的软件开发环境。 此外,手册可能还会分享来自SEL的实际案例研究,这些案例可以为项目经理提供宝贵的经验教训和实用建议。这份资源对于那些负责软件开发项目的项目经理来说,是一份非常有价值的参考资料,可以帮助他们更有效地管理和执行项目。